Objectives of Programme's Learning Outcomes

Learning Outcomes of UE

At the end of the instruction, the students will be able to: - to use basic English grammar in a medical/scientific context - extract information from medical/scientific texts in English - work independently on audio/video documents at level B1 - use medical and scientific vocabulary - apply the basic rules of pronunciation in English

Content of UE

English grammar; medical vocabulary; reading and listening; self-learning; introduction to pronunciation, speaking

Prior Experience

General English 'cours interfacultaires' highly recommended for complete beginners in block 1.
